Beschreibung

In 'Practical Bookbinding' by Paul Adam, readers are introduced to the art of bookbinding in a detailed and accessible manner. The book provides step-by-step instructions on various bookbinding techniques, making it suitable for both beginners and experienced bookbinders. Adam's literary style is straightforward and instructional, with clear illustrations to aid the reader in understanding the process. The book is a valuable resource for anyone interested in the craft of bookbinding, offering practical tips and techniques to create beautiful and durable bindings. It also delves into the history of bookbinding and its significance in the literary world, giving readers a broader context to appreciate the art form. Paul Adam's expertise in bookbinding shines through in this comprehensive guide, making it a must-have for book enthusiasts and craftsmen alike. Whether you are a novice looking to learn a new skill or a seasoned bookbinder wanting to refine your techniques, 'Practical Bookbinding' is the perfect guide to help you on your journey.

Autorenportrait

Paul Adam is not widely known as a literary figure, and contemporary recognition of his work remains primarily within the specialized realms of bibliophiles and book conservationists. His most notable contribution, 'Practical Bookbinding,' serves as a seminal text for those interested in the craft and preservation of bound literature. The book offers a comprehensive guide to traditional bookbinding methodologies, blending historical techniques with practical applications. Adam's prose reveals a meticulous attention to detail that can only be borne of a profound respect for both the written word and the physical vessel that contains it. His approach to bookbinding emphasizes not just the technical aspects of the craft, but also the artistry and philosophical importance of preserving the integrity and longevity of books. Despite the specificity of his subject matter, details about Adam's life, education, and broader literary contributions remain elusive, which often is the case with authors who specialize in highly technical manuals or niche subjects. Paul Adam's legacy resides in the pages of his guide, which continues to educate and inspire future generations of bookbinders.
